Karl Jones’ last live double album “Spirit Room” has 11 download hits on Spotify. This well-known guitarist has an Irish brewery/Temple Lane Dublin upbringing and specializes in a unique mix of blues/jazz influences and Celtic flavored Americana. His latest original, Spanish Armada recorded by Tim Jessup, has had radio play on Gulch Radio. His originals are found on You tube at Karl Jones music.
Karl Jones is from Dublin Ireland and has been living and working as a tour guide in Sedona for years. He is an accomplished singer / songwriter / guitarist with radio and television appearances in both Ireland and the US to his credit.
Karl had a chance meeting with Thomas Banyacya, a Hopi Elder, in 1996 after an American concert at George Washington University in Washington DC. Thomas was on a speaking tour of the East Coast, teaching the public about Hopi spirituality and world view. Their meeting led to an invitation to Arizona to visit the Hopi Reservation, and Karl discovered Sedona along the way.

Born in the Verde Valley of Arizona, The Invincible Grins fuse eclecticism with unbridled enthusiasm, creating a unique and danceable style of sweaty rock and roll. Marrying strong and original songwriting with undeniable groove, the Grins draw inspiration from such artists as Tom Waits, Woody Guthrie, Andrew Bird, Talking Heads, Morphine, and Goran Bregovic, and have also been accused of sounding like “Gogol Bordello meets Fleetwood Mac.” Their music has been described as “funked-up folk”, “Gypsybilly”, and simply, “…like fun!” No matter what moniker is applied, one thing is for sure: The Invincible Grins are upbeat music for a beat up world. They remind you to have a drink and dance. Take it easy. Brace yourself. Everything’s gonna be alright!
